Exploring the Causes of Hair and Scalp Problems

The root causes behind these common issues can be varied and complex. Dandruff may result from an overgrowth of the yeast Malassezia on the scalp, while hair thinning and breakage typically stem from factors such as hormonal changes, poor nutrition, stress, or improper hair care practices. Dry scalp might be a consequence of insufficient sebum production or exposure to harsh weather conditions. Understanding these causes is essential in finding effective and natural remedies that can restore scalp health and promote vibrant hair.

Evidence-Based Natural Remedies

Nature has provided us with an array of botanicals and plant oils that have been used for centuries to address hair and scalp concerns. Incorporating these into your routine can offer a holistic approach to hair care:

  • Rosemary Oil: Known for its antioxidant properties, rosemary oil can improve circulation to the scalp, potentially stimulating hair follicles and supporting hair growth.

  • Jojoba Oil: Resembling the scalp’s natural sebum, jojoba oil is an excellent moisturizer, helping to maintain balance and prevent dryness.

  • Pumpkin Seed Oil: Rich in essential fatty acids, it nourishes the scalp and has been linked with improved hair thickness.

  • Moringa Oil: Packed with vitamins and minerals, moringa oil provides nourishment and protection, aiding in the reduction of oxidative stress on the scalp.

Ingredient Benefits Explained

Each of these botanical ingredients brings unique benefits to hair care. Rosemary oil not only enhances circulation but also has antimicrobial properties that support a healthy scalp environment. The likeness of jojoba oil to human sebum allows it to penetrate the hair follicle effectively, providing deep hydration without leaving a greasy residue. Pumpkin seed oil is a treasure trove of nutrients like zinc and vitamin E, which are crucial for maintaining scalp health and promoting hair density. Meanwhile, moringa oil, with its high concentration of vitamins A, C, and E, acts as a powerful antioxidant, offering protection from environmental damage.

How to Use Natural Oils in Your Daily Routine

Incorporating these oils into your hair care routine can be simple and effective. Here’s a step-by-step guide:

  1. Pre-wash Treatment: Once or twice a week, apply a few drops of your chosen oil to the scalp and gently massage for 5-10 minutes. This helps to improve blood circulation and promotes healthier hair growth. Let it sit for at least 30 minutes, then wash as usual.

  2. During Conditioner: Add a few drops of oil to your regular conditioner to boost its hydrating effects.

  3. Scalp Massage: Regularly massaging the scalp with these oils can relieve tension and increase relaxing effects.

  4. Natural Hair Mask: Combine oils like rosemary and jojoba with honey or avocados to create a hydrating hair mask.

  5. Styling Aid: Use a small amount of oil on damp hair to lock in moisture, reduce frizz, and add shine.
